Transformative Solutions for Diverse Sectors
One of Sungrow’s flagship offerings making waves in Africa is the PowerStack 200CS hybrid system, integrated with the SG150CX string inverter. This combination is already in operation in shopping malls, eco-lodges, and data centres, ensuring seamless transitions between grid and off-grid supply. Its ability to stabilise frequency, reduce peak demand charges, and lower operational costs makes it particularly valuable for energy-intensive industries like mining, manufacturing, and digital infrastructure.
Beyond individual businesses, Sungrow has also spearheaded large-scale projects across Africa.
-
In South Africa, a 516 MWh energy storage system has been deployed to strengthen grid resilience and reduce load-shedding.
-
In Ghana, Sungrow supported a major rooftop solar project, cutting emissions while powering urban infrastructure.
-
In South Africa’s mining sector, two 100MW solar projects are reducing both costs and carbon footprints, showing how renewable adoption directly fuels economic competitiveness.
Storage as the Backbone of a Resilient Energy Future
A highlight of Sungrow’s exhibition was the unveiling of the PowerTitan 2.0 energy storage system. Unlike traditional batteries, this next-generation solution leverages AI-driven energy dispatch to balance supply and demand more intelligently. By storing excess solar and wind energy and shifting it to peak demand periods, PowerTitan 2.0 not only reduces reliance on fossil fuel peaker plants but also stabilises grid frequency and prevents blackouts.
This technology is particularly significant for South Africa’s Just Energy Transition (JET) goals, where phasing out coal must be balanced with providing reliable power for households, industries, and essential services. Advanced storage ensures that renewable energy remains dependable, affordable, and capable of supporting industrial growth without sacrificing stability.
